The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Rolling Green takes 17.0 minutes. That's shorter than the US average of 26.4 minutes.

How people in Rolling Green get to work:
- 78.6% drive their own car alone
- 3.9% carpool with others
- 16.5% work from home
- 0.0% take mass transit
